Casement Windows 101: What Makes Them So Special?
First off, let’s clear the air: casement windows aren’t your grandma’s crank-and-complain relics. Modern designs are sleek, intuitive, and packed with perks. Picture a window that swings outward like a door (hence the name “casement”), operated by a simple crank. No more straining to reach high hinges or dealing with sashes that slam shut.
Why we’re obsessed:
- Unbeatable ventilation: They catch breezes like a sailboat, directing airflow straight into your home.
- Energy efficiency: Airtight seals? Check. Lower heating bills? Double-check.
- Easy cleaning: No acrobatics required—just crank them open and wipe from the inside.

Energy Efficiency: Your Wallet Will Thank You
Let’s get real—nobody likes paying more for heating than they have to. Casement windows are energy-efficient windows royalty because of their compression seals. When closed, they lock tightly against the frame, leaving zero room for drafts.

Design Flexibility: Because Your Home Isn’t a Cookie-Cutter Box
Casement windows aren’t just functional—they’re stylish. Whether your vibe is modern farmhouse or mid-century minimalist, these windows adapt.
Why they’re design chameleons:
- Frame materials: Choose from vinyl, wood, or fiberglass to match your aesthetic.
- Panoramic views: No center rail means unobstructed sightlines. Perfect for that backyard oasis you’ve been curating.

Security: Because Burglars Aren’t Welcome Here
Ever seen a movie where the hero sneaks in through a poorly latched window? With casement windows, that script gets rewritten.
Security perks:
- Multi-point locking systems: These windows lock at multiple spots along the frame. Take that, would-be intruders!
- No accidental gaps: Since they seal tightly, there’s no wiggle room for pry bars.

Cost: Breaking Down the Price Tag (Without the Panic)
Okay, let’s address the elephant in the room: What’s the damage to your wallet?
Casement windows can cost slightly more upfront than double-hung styles. But IMO, the long-term savings on energy bills and maintenance make them a smart investment.
Factors affecting price:
- Material: Vinyl is budget-friendly; wood is pricier but oh-so-chic.
- Size and customization: Larger or uniquely shaped windows? Expect a bump in cost.
